Key Ceremony Checklist — SnackLoop Restock Planner

[ ] Step 7: Rotate the signing key for the SnackLoop planner's dispatch queue. Two witnesses needed (grab whoever's free from the Harrowgate platform team). Once both sign off, seal the old key in the escrow envelope. The escrow unlock phrase goes right here for the record.

vault phrase of bagaf-kajeg = jorath-feniel-briir-siliel-ralix

TICKET-4417: Vault locked, replica lag alarm firing

Priority: P1. LagWatch alarm on billing read-replica exceeded 900s. Root cause likely the stuck WAL shipper on node grebe-2. Fix requires creds from the Coldbox vault, but Coldbox auto-locked after three failed unseal attempts during last week's drill. On-call: do NOT retry unseal blind. Restart grebe-2's shipper only after vault access is restored. Unseal Coldbox using the recovery passphrase below.

strongbox words: briiel-zoreth-noveth-pelys-druwyn-feniel-lamvan-ulaius-kasion

## Releases

Plugin authors extending the Fernhollow admin table should note that bulk edits shipped in release 4.2. Bulk operations now emit a single batched event instead of per-row hooks, so update your listeners accordingly. All release tarballs are signed, and you should verify downloads before packaging. Verification uses the following public signing key.

signing key of bagap-yawep = bky13_TbfT6ZMUoGJo2

**Vendor note: Inkmill markdown pipeline**

Rendering for Parchway docs is outsourced to Inkmill under an annual contract, renewing each March. They handle sanitization and PDF export; we own the upload queue. SLA: 4-hour response on rendering failures. Escalate only after two failed retries. Their support desk is reachable at the address below.

billing contact of hahaf-baguf = zorael.tammir.jorius@sivrelhq.internal